Organic coffee beans are grown using environmentally responsible practices and are free from synthetic chemicals. Here’s what customers often ask when choosing natural organic coffee.

Organic coffee beans are grown using natural, environmentally friendly farming methods that avoid synthetic chemicals. Instead of relying on pesticides, herbicides, or chemical fertilizers, organic farms use compost, crop rotation, shade-growing, and other sustainable practices to nurture healthy soil and plants.

This approach promotes:

  • Cleaner, chemical-free beans
  • Healthier soil and biodiversity
  • Safe, eco-conscious farming practices

In short, organic coffee focuses on how the beans are grown and harvested, using nature to produce pure, flavorful coffee without artificial inputs.
